Handover — Dovetail read-replica lag alarm. Alarm fires when replica lag on the Brackenport cluster exceeds 90s. Root cause is the nightly vacuum colliding with the analytics pull; fix is in the open patch, please review the backoff logic carefully. If the alarm pages before merge, silence it and fail reads over manually. Console access for the failover requires the recovery passphrase below.

recovery phrase for fafof-kagaf: eliath-zormir

# Break-glass: Catalog Cache Invalidation

Scope: Fennick product catalog, cache tier only. Normal invalidation flows through the Brayle pipeline. Break-glass applies when stale prices persist past SLA and the pipeline is down. Procedure: page the catalog on-call, log intent in the incident channel, then flush via the emergency console. Access is dual-controlled and audited; sessions expire after 15 minutes. The emergency console unlocks with the passphrase below.

vault phrase of yawig-bawig = fenael-norael-eliox-gilox-casath-druath-zorys-istwyn-jorwyn

**Ticket: Config drift on ScanBridge kiosks**

Support has reported intermittent barcode read failures at the Harlow Depot kiosks. Investigation shows the ScanBridge integration on three units drifted from the managed baseline — likely a manual change during last month's troubleshooting that was never reverted. Symptoms match the stale decoder timeout. Please re-apply the baseline on affected kiosks and confirm scans succeed. The expected baseline configuration is listed below.

config for badup-kagap:
OLIOX_PIN=5344
OLIOX_METRICS_HOST=metrics.oliox.zemvarcorp.corp
OLIOX_LOG_LEVEL=error
OLIOX_TENANT=pelox

## Data Stores — StallSense Occupancy Feed

StallSense ingests gate sensor events from the Keldham garages into a staging queue, then writes five-minute occupancy rollups to the primary store. Raw events expire after 72 hours; rollups are retained indefinitely. Reviewers: check that any new query hits the rollup table, not raw events. For verifying query plans against staging, connect with the string below.

primary connection of yagep-kahip = redis://giliel_svc:zYiKsLL2PLpfPL@db-348f.xolmarsys.corp:5432/fenwyn